David GOMBE

England national league side Ebbsfleet United FC has signed Ugandan forward Nathan Odokonyero.

Odokonyero joins Ebbsfleet United FC from Isthmian Premier league side Bognor Regis Town.

“Dennis Kutrieb has added to the Fleet’s 2023/24 squad with the capture of Bognor Regis Town striker Nathan Odokonyero for an undisclosed fee.” The club confirmed Odokonyero signing

“For me to grow and develop, I felt the time was right for the move to a better league and a team like Ebbsfleet suits me down to a tee so it was an easy decision to join. Ever since I’ve come in, I’ve enjoyed it so much and it’s great to sign for the club.” Odokonyero expressed his delight upon the move

Ebbsfleet head coach Kutrieb expects Odokonyero to prevail

“He’s an interesting signing for us now and for the future and one to develop in the right direction. He’s very young and I wouldn’t be surprised if he can make his way even higher. I can see his workrate, I can see his talent and quality so it’s a really positive move for us.” He told the club website.

Odokonyero struck 25 goals in the Isthmian Premier in 2022/23 where he finished among the top three scorers in that division. In the season before that, he fired 11 more aged just 17 after stepping up from Lincoln City’s academy, a total of 36 goals in his last 50 starts at senior level.
